At The Learning Community, a charter school in Central Falls, R.I., students spent recess on an old parking lot until a fourth grader wrote to Lowe's asking for help. They sent $110,000.

The new playground was designed by Laurencia Strauss, a Rhode Island School of Design graduate, as "part playground, part park, part sculpture" to provide space for both active play and quiet reflection. Creative use of inexpensive elements like round pre-cast stepping stones and galvanized water troughs, good use of plants...and the sandpit is a pool!
